Both Headless Cross and Tyr are mighty. As is Eternal Idol, but that isn't in the boxset. Cross Purposes has really grown on me over the years too. Forbidden has some cracking riffs too, but is very confused sounding, and poorly produced. Having Ernie C as producer was folly, especially as he apparently was acting like Cozy Powell couldn't play drums, and was telling Iommi how to play. And he had Ice - T involved, which was an abomination.
